How to Properly Use and Preserve a Wooden Bunk Bed

Wooden bunk beds are an excellent service for many families. They supply kids with plenty of space to sleep and play, while freeing up flooring area in little spaces.

Bunk beds are also a stylish choice that will complement any bed room decor. However, there are some important things to keep in mind when selecting a wooden bunk.
Durability

Wooden bunks can hold up against heavy usage for longer amount of times than their metal equivalents. They can be used for years without requiring extensive maintenance or repair work, making them a wise financial investment for households with active children. They also can be found in a variety of colors and designs to complement any space decoration, and they are easy to clean and preserve.

When picking a wooden bunk, search for quality wood that is durable and long-lasting. Oak, maple, and pine are all good options. They are strong and long lasting, with stunning grain patterns and rich color tones. Wood is also an ecologically friendly product, and it can be shaped and crafted into lots of different designs.

Another factor to consider is how the bunk bed will be used. If it will be shared by 2 young kids, you may wish to think about a set that features stairs rather of ladders. Stairs are much easier for kids to climb and reduce the threat of injury. In addition, they can create a sense of belonging in the room by encouraging kids to keep their beds organized and tidy.

The cost of a wooden bunk can vary depending upon the size and style of the bed, along with the products utilized to construct it. For example, some designs may include a mix of birch and MDF, which is a strong and resilient product. You need to likewise pay attention to the completing of the bunk bed, as this will affect its resilience and aesthetic appeals. You can pick from various ending up options, consisting of painted finishes, spots, and natural wood.

Safety

A wooden bunk bed is a fantastic alternative for families with children, however it needs to be effectively utilized and kept to ensure security. The first action is to make sure the bunk beds are made with quality products and abide by market security guidelines. This includes guaranteeing that the wood is dealt with or painted with non-toxic materials and that all connections are securely attached. It is likewise essential to routinely examine the bunk beds for any indications of wear and tear. This will assist to prevent accidents and extend the life of the furnishings.


In addition to regular evaluations, it is also essential to periodically clean up the bunk beds. This will assist to lower the build-up of dirt and dust, which can harm the wood with time. Use a soft cloth or duster to eliminate dust and dirt, then clean the surface of the furnishings with mild soap and water. If required, you can even use a sponge that is slightly wet with a little bit of water to eliminate stubborn spots.

If possible, it is recommended to keep the bunk beds out of direct sunshine, as prolonged exposure can trigger them to warp or fade. To prevent this, you can cover them with drapes or blinds throughout peak sun hours.  cherry wood bunk beds  is likewise a great idea to put protective pads under any decorative items that are put on the bunks, as these can scratch or mark the surface area of the furnishings.

When it comes to repair work, it is necessary to attend to any minor damages as quickly as they happen. This will help to prevent them from intensifying into larger issues that might impact the security of those utilizing the bed. For instance, squeaky beds can normally be repaired by tightening up screws or bolts, and damages can often be repaired with wood filler or touch-up paint.

It is likewise crucial to frequently check the bunk beds for any loose or damaged parts, specifically those that lie in high-stress locations such as the joints and guardrails. This will help to avoid any accidents or injuries that could happen as an outcome of faulty elements.
Space-Saving

Wooden bunks are an effective way to maximize the sleeping capability of a bedroom. They save space by integrating 2 single beds into one system, and they can also lower space clutter by enabling kids to sleep, study, or play in their own area without troubling each other. They are a fantastic option for shared spaces, and they can even function as a reliable method to accommodate extra visitors.

Bunks are likewise more economical than traditional twin sized beds. Depending on the design of bunk bed, some cost just $100 per set, significantly less than the cost of two separate, full-sized mattresses. In addition, bunks use more storage space than standard beds, enabling you to use the additional space for books, toys, or other items.

In terms of aesthetics, wooden bunks have a traditional design that matches a wide array of space design styles. On the other hand, metal bunks have a more contemporary and commercial appearance that might clash with specific decor choices. Furthermore, wood is more durable than metal, making it a much better option for long-lasting usage.

While most bunk beds are made from pine, oak, or maple, each type has its own special color tones, grain patterns, and durability levels. The type of wood picked will ultimately determine the general quality and appearance of the bunk bed.

The option of wood is especially important when it comes to security, as some kinds of wood are more vulnerable to damage than others. In specific, pine bunks are more prone to scratches and dents than other materials, which can be especially hazardous for young kids.

Style

Wooden bunks have a classic and ageless design that complements lots of space decors. They can likewise be personalized to fit your choices and spending plan. They are perfect for shared bedrooms and accommodating guests. Nevertheless, you should consider the precaution, different types and designs, and maintenance pointers when purchasing wooden bunks for your home.

It is important to select a quality bunk bed that adheres to market safety requirements. Examine whether it has tough side rails and a center support to prevent injuries to your children. In addition, it needs to have a guardrail on the top bunk to secure your children from falling off the bed. It is also crucial to follow the producer's guidelines thoroughly when assembling and setting up the bunk beds. Inappropriate installation or assembly can compromise the structural integrity of the bunk bed, putting your kids at risk of injury.
